McMahon and Beck homers send MLB-worst Rockies to a 6-4 win over the Twins

Colorado Rockies’ Jordan Beck follows the flight of his solo home run off Minnesota Twins starting pitcher Chris Paddack in the second inning of a baseball game Friday, July 18, 2025, in Denver. (AP Photo/David Zalubowski)


DENVER (AP) — Ryan McMahon’s two-run homer capped a four-run first inning, Jordan Beck homered and finished a double shy of hitting for the cycle and the MLB-worst Colorado Rockies opened their second half of the season with a 6-4 win over the Minnesota Twins on Friday night.

The Rockies had four straight extra-base hits in the bottom of the first with doubles by Tyler Freeman and Mickey Moniak, a triple by Beck and McMahon’s 14th home run.
